基于精简指令集计算机的多串口网口通信体系构建策略研究

Construction strategy based on reduced instruction set computer network port multiport serial communication system
下载PDF
导出
摘要 本文主要简单的介绍了精简指令集计算机的基本内容,对精简指令集计算机的优势进行分析。通过对精简指令集计算机的结构特点,来探索基于精简指令集计算机多串口网口通信的结构和装置,以建立健全的以精简指令集计算机为基础的多串口网口通信体系构建。据此,有利于进一步的开发和研究这一通信体系,使其能在电力系统二次设备的计算机监控系统中发挥重要的作用,提高基于精简指令集计算机多串口网口通信工程的有效性。 This paper simply introduces the Reduced Instruction Set Computer basic content,the advantage of reduced instruction set computer for analysis.Through the reduced instruction set computer structural features,to explore the structure-based streamline multiple serial port communication network and device instruction set computer to establish a sound to reduced instruction set computer-based multi-port serial communication network system construction.Accordingly,there is conducive to further development and research in this communication system,so that it can play an important role in the computer monitoring system of secondary power system equipment,and improve the effectiveness of multi-set computer serial port communication network project based on Reduced Instruction.
